National Bank of Scotland Limited, £5, 1 July 1955, serial number D919-312, blue and yellow with a red sunburst design in background, The Marquess of Lothian and the Clyde at left, Edinburgh Castle and Holyrood Palace at right, arms at centre, Dandie and Alexander signatures, reverse blue, Princes Street and value at left and right, and £5, 1 December 1955, serial number E320-205, colour and design as previous
(Douglas 35-8, Banknote Yearbook SC512g), about uncirculated to uncirculated (2)
